real estate: CMA...You mean Country Music Award? No...Comparative Market Analysis! - 04/18/09 02:44 PM

When you are ready to enter the market to sell your home one of the first things you will need is a CMA or Comparative Market Analysis.
A CMA is a comprehensive detailed report of the real estate market inside your neighborhood and the surrounding area that shows you the statistical information that you need to arrive at a correct price at which to offer your home for sale on the market.
In this report you will find the ACTIVE LISTINGS - Homes that are presently on the market....YOUR Competition.

real estate: Market Report - 1st Quarter - Helena, Alabama 35080 - 04/09/09 06:53 PM
 
When you gaze upon the waters you have a tendency to reflect back and see where you have been and think about where you may be going. 
When we compare the market activity in the 1st quarter of 2008 to the 1st quarter of 2009 we can see that Active listing inventory is slightly down with 259 homes presently on the market compared to 275 Actives last year.  There were 67 homes that were withdrawn or expired off the market without selling in 2008 compared to only 56 homes in 2009.

Do you have aging parents that have reached a time in their lives where thy just do not need to continue to live alone but a senior facility is just not the answer? 
Mother-in-Law Apartment A mother-in-law apartment is a small apartment accessory to a primary residence. Alternative names include "granny flat", "granny suite""in-law suite", and "accessory apartment", the first being used primarily in Australia and Britain, where it is the most familiar of these terms, but also in parts of theUnited States. real estate: Saving the Great American Dream! - 12/19/08 06:40 PM
 
There are 13349 homes on the market in the Greater Birmingham area today and of those 1517 are foreclosed properties.
Statistics show there are 6 major reasons for foreclosure
                              1. Loss of Income                              2. Death of a Borrower                              3. Divorce                              4. Over Extended Credit                              5. Illness                              6. Gambling
Understanding the Foreclosure Process could possibly help to prevent some of these foreclosures from ever taking place.  There are three types of foreclosure proceedings -
          Non Judicial, Judicial, and Strict

real estate: Interest Rates at Historical Lows! - 12/18/08 07:14 PM
 
30-YEAR FIXED RATES AT HISTORICAL  LOWS!!! According to the Primary Mortgage Market Survey®published today   at Freddiemac.com the average rate in the Southeast on a 30 Year Conventional Fixed Mortgage is at 5.24% and 4.95% for a 15 Year term. Of course these rates can vary a bit from lender to lender but these are incredible Mortgage loan interest rates! (The APR will vary on these approximate rates based on the amount of closing costs charged by the lender of your choice)
